Central America’s solar boom: Central American nations have emerged from obscurity to a leading role in the deployment and integration of large amounts of renewable energy. But the Energy Transition in this region is just beginning.
Central America is a region composed of countries very unlike the Western nations that have deployed large volumes of renewable energy to date.
